Huffington Post More Valuable Than Some Newspaper Cos.

As long-rumored, The Huffington Post took $25 million in new funding at a $100 million valuation. It's a healthy sum given the company has aggregated a huge audience — 8.8 million people a month, according to Quantcast — primarily on links to content it does not produce (newspaper stories) or pay for (columns). The funding means Arianna Huffington's news blog is now considered more valuable by its backers than quite a few publicly traded newspaper companies.
